- •Постоянная память. Структура и работа пп
- •Система прерываний и приоритетов. Назначение. Работа при обработке запросов
- •Машинная команда. Структура машинной команды
- •Система команд учебной эвм. Структура одноадресных и двухадресных команд
- •Система команд микропроцессора к580. Структура команды
- •Признаки результата (флаги). Их назначение и использование
- •Особенности команд условного и безусловного перехода
- •Принцип отображения информации на цифровом дисплее микропроцессорного стенда
- •Методы адресации. Регистровый, косвенно-регистровый, прямой (абсолютный), относительный и непосредственный методы адресации
- •Структура микропроцессора. Назначение составных частей
- •Работа микропроцессора при выполнении команд
Постоянная память. Структура и работа пп
Система прерываний и приоритетов. Назначение. Работа при обработке запросов
Система прерывания предназначена для прерывания текущей программы, запуска прерывающей и последующего возвращения к текущей программе.
Запрос на прерывание фиксируется в регистре прерывания. Эти запросы группируются по приоритетам. При появлении запроса по окончанию выполняемой программы текущая программа прерывается. Далее управление передается прерывающей программе. Адрес начала этой программы зависит от вида запроса. Этот адрес поступает на счетчик команд и начинается выполнение прерывающей программе. После ее завершения восстанавливается состояние процессора и продолжается текущая программа.
В зависимости от глубины прерывания прерывающая программа также может прерываться при поступлении запроса с более высоким приоритетом. Самым высоким приоритетом обладают системы контроля.
Машинная команда. Структура машинной команды
Машинная команда – управляющая информация для выполнения компьютером определенной операции.
Команды состоят из частей:
Код операции (Что делать) |
Адресная часть (С чем делать) |
|
Результат в одну из ячеек |
Сложить число из аккума с числом из ячейки, результат в аккум |
Разрядность – 16 двоичной разрядности
РОН (Р0-Р7), где Р6, Р7 – специального назначения
Система команд учебной эвм. Структура одноадресных и двухадресных команд
В учебной ЭВМ используются одноадресные и двух адресные команды
|
или |
|
Двухадресная команда
Коп |
SSS |
DDD |
|||||||||||||
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
Коп |
№ режима адресации |
№ регистра |
№ режима адресации |
№ регистра |
Одноадресная команда
Коп |
DDD |
||||||||||||||
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
фы |
Коп |
№ режима адресации |
№ регистра |